Ticket AW-431: The Placefill autocomplete widget now debounces keystrokes at 200ms and caches the last twenty suggestion sets client-side. The change touches the shared input component used by three checkout flows at Merrowden Retail. Please review the cache invalidation logic and the fallback when the suggestion service times out. Merge is blocked pending sign-off from the reviewer named below.

named custodian: Fraion Holael

[ ] Orphaned-resource sweeper — confirm the Tidewrack sweeper ran in dry-run mode first and that the candidate list looks sane (no live volumes!). Future maintainers: the grace window is 72h on purpose; don't shorten it without asking ops. The sweeper build that produced the approved dry-run report is noted below.

pipeline stamp: htk9_6ce9d33c5

**Vendor note: Inkmill markdown pipeline**

Rendering for Parchway docs is outsourced to Inkmill under an annual contract, renewing each March. They handle sanitization and PDF export; we own the upload queue. SLA: 4-hour response on rendering failures. Escalate only after two failed retries. Their support desk is reachable at the address below.

billing contact of hahaf-baguf = zorael.tammir.jorius@sivrelhq.internal

## Deployment

The Crashloom pipeline ingests symbolicated reports from both mobile platforms and batches them into the triage queue every five minutes. Deploys are blue-green; drain the ingest workers before switching. Symbol uploads must complete before the app build is promoted, or reports arrive unreadable. Sampling and retention are tuned per release ring. The values currently applied in production appear below.

deployment values, kajep-kageg:
[praix]
host = praix.paliqcorp.corp
user = praix_svc
database = praix_prod